GitHub’s free offering, on the other hand, comes with unlimited public and private repositories, with unlimited collaborators. red crab bar odessaThe core difference is GitLab has Continuous Integration/Continuous Delivery (CI/CD) and DevOps workflows built-in. GitHub lets you work with the CI/CD tools of your choice, but you'll need to integrate them yourself. GitHub users typically work with a third-party CI program such as Jenkins, CircleCI, or TravisCI. … See more Still, they look more like each other than not.
